I do feel the metaphors dragged on too long. As lovely as they were, it took away from some of the emotional moments. I also found that some of the dialogue was repeated so often that the sayings lost their impact. (Ex: "You're okay. I've got you," was said whenever someone had a an emotional moment)
I also would have appreciated a break in between character deaths. 3 in a row was quite a lot.
That all being said, i did enjoy the novel and hope to see the growth I believe Lancali is capable of!

Okay, I sat. Let's start with the positives, I do think this book is worth the read, IF YOU ARE LOOKING FOR A SIGN TO READ THIS BOOK, THIS IS IT. This is a beautifully written book. I got extremely attached to the characters and audibly cried at least seven times. It's sad and real and really forces you take a step back and look at things with a different perspective.
The only reason this book is a 4.25 stars instead of 5 is because (1) felt the author's writing was extremely poetic, metaphorical, and flowery, almost to a point of fault. It felt like every line was a quote that you should be annotating. I think you should know that after listening to lancali talk, I have come to realize that that is just her natural way of speaking. Also, the big reveal at the end wasn't my favorite but the 200 pages leading up to it were heart-wrenching.
(2) From the beginning, the main character and her love interest werent my favorite characters in the world. Not to say I didn't like them, I truly did but Neo, Coeur, and Sony really tugged at my heartstrings. I felt like I was being told about their immense love for each other but I didn't feel it. There was never a moment in the book where I was giddy and kicking my feet for them to get together. It was more of "this person is the bane of my existence" the very first time they met.
This review is not meant to scare you away from reading it, it is a great book, these are just slight things that pop up in the book that pushed my rating down from a 5 star. To not end this on a negative note I loved this book. The positives outway the negatives by far and the problems I mention in this review are not as big of a deal as I'm making them out to be.
